• 'Machete' Production Photos

    Fan of it? 1 fan
    Super Fan

    Michelle Rodriguez poses in front of a green screen for Machete photos. (images from http://laughterizer.weebly.com) (Source: Troublemaker Studios)

    Keyword: machete, promotional, production, photos, green screen, 2010, michelle rodriguez, luz, she

Around the Web


click to comment

Michelle Rodriguez Hot on Fanpop